Economic theory of the last fifty years has been dominated by the paradigm of General Equilibrium Theory, based on the scientific work of Walras-Pareto-Cassel-Wald-Hicks-Arrow-De breu-McKenzie. Some of its grounding assumptions are: all prices are fully flexible; an auctioneer appropriately manipulates all prices according to the law of supply and demand; every con sumer has only one budget constraint; all agents are perfectly informed; no actions are taken by agents before a vector of prices has been found such that all markets clear. Indeed, when all markets clear every agent can implement her/his chosen (opti mal) action and nobody is urged to change his/her decisions. Under these assumptions it is generally said that in a (one pe riod, competitive) general equilibrium model there is no place for money. The present monograph takes general equilibrium as the ba sis on which to build the model presented. But its first aim is to completely dispense with the Walrasian auctioneer by giving firms the task of choosing their output price~ period after period.

Provides a step-by-step introduction to applied general equilibrium modelling of trade policy reforms and regional economic integration initiatives. Includes a detailed description of a contemporary practical application to assess the economic consequences of the single European Market.

'To non-economists, it is hard to understand why economists spend so much effort on the competitive model whereas the world seems to be replete with large and powerful economic actors. In this respect, Jean Gabszewicz is atypical: he has spent most of his research time working on imperfectly competitive markets. However, instead of restricting himself to partial equilibrium analyses, he has tackled from the outset the problem of imperfect competition in a system of interrelated markets with the aim of studying how market power is spread throughout the whole system. This is one of the most challenging and fascinating tasks that economists face. But this is also a very hard one, and may explain why so few have tried. This book builds on the seminal contributions of Cournot and Edgeworth and does not intend to provide a full-fledged answer to the many questions raised by the general theory of imperfect competition. However, by presenting in a transparent way most of the problems that lie at the roots of imperfect competition in general equilibrium and by proposing various elegant solutions, it paves the way to any future research in the field. No doubt it will become a basic reference in the long run. Contrary to the classical competitive paradigm in which agents are assumed to behave as price takers, here traders are allowed to consciously behave as strategic agents who aim to influence trade to their own advantage. This is usually done in oligopoly theory using a partial equilibrium approach while in this case a system of interrelated markets is considered.
